2009 Bugatti Veyron vs. 2005 Porsche 911

To start off, 2009 Bugatti Veyron is newer by 4 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 2005 Porsche 911.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 2005 Porsche 911 would be higher. At 7,993 cc (16 cylinders), 2009 Bugatti Veyron is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2009 Bugatti Veyron (987 HP @ 6000 RPM) has 542 more horse power than 2005 Porsche 911. (445 HP @ 6000 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 2009 Bugatti Veyron should accelerate faster than 2005 Porsche 911.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2009 Bugatti Veyron weights approximately 297 kg more than 2005 Porsche 911.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.

Let's talk about torque, 2009 Bugatti Veyron (1,250 Nm) has 630 more torque (in Nm) than 2005 Porsche 911. (620 Nm). This means 2009 Bugatti Veyron will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2005 Porsche 911.
